(Baonghean.vn) - The summit between Russian President Vladimir Putin and his US counterpart Donald Trump has proven that global issues can be solved through dialogue. That is the comment of Austrian Chancellor Sebastian Kurz posted on Twitter on July 17.

"The meeting in Helsinki is a sign that global tensions can be resolved through dialogue," the Austrian chancellor wrote on Twitter, adding: "Expanding cooperation between the two great powers Russia and the United States is especially important to ensure nuclear disarmament and a peaceful solution to the conflict in Syria, while protecting security in Israel."

The first official meeting between the two leaders of Russia and the United States was held in Helsinki, Finland on July 16. The one-on-one meeting between Putin and Trump lasted more than 2 hours.

The Russian delegation includes Russian Foreign Minister Sergey Lavrov, Kremlin spokesman Dmitry Peskov and Russian presidential aide Yuri Ushakov. On the US side, accompanying Mr. Trump in this meeting includes US Secretary of State Michael Pompeo and US security adviser John Bolton.
